Output 21d52a9805bb533a0c9282dabe457a0e04d902a3018266e927dcf56cfa0d2da8:19

value
13992666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ca6ee88db39c99ea2ab4261af4c47fafe2229240 OP_EQUAL
address
3L9PHLy5k631s4w5wcYvkYcm6CFpDa77hP
transaction
21d52a9805bb533a0c9282dabe457a0e04d902a3018266e927dcf56cfa0d2da8
spent
true